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03 315156 29 926
76208307 481275417 7773920860
76208307 481275417 7773920860
25395044 01012907855 2294
All about undefined
Interested in learning more?
76208307 481275417 7773920860
25395044 01012907855 2294
See more
524411033 643089 66996759081
8546763539 72556453 2725
See more
3885837 98388028683
073521 8221331 94625516
See more